Dell 400-AXTV — 480GB Read-Intensive TLC SATA 6Gb/s 2.5" Hot-Plug SSD

The Dell 400-AXTV is a server-grade solid-state drive designed for read-intensive workloads in modern PowerEdge infrastructures. This 480GB 2.5-inch SATA SSD uses TLC NAND and 512e advanced format to deliver consistent read performance, low latency and power-efficient storage for applications such as content delivery, caching and large-scale file serving.

Key specifications & technical summary

  • Manufacturer: Dell
  • Model / SKU: 400-AXTV
  • Capacity: 480 GB (usable solid-state capacity)
  • Form factor: 2.5-inch, 512e advanced sector format
  • Interface: SATA 6.0 Gbps (SATA III)
  • NAND type: TLC (Triple-Level Cell) — optimized for read-centred tasks
  • Hot-plug / Hot-swap: Compatible with hot-swap bays for uninterrupted maintenance
  • Intended workload: Read-intensive enterprise/server environments

Performance characteristics

While engineered for read-heavy workloads, the Dell 400-AXTV balances throughput and endurance. Expect improved read IOPS and fast access times compared with mechanical disks, making it ideal for database read replicas, web servers and caching layers.

Technical Specifications and Performance Metrics

Interface and Form Factor Compatibility

The Dell 400-AXTV utilizes the ubiquitous SATA 6Gbps interface, providing broad compatibility with existing server infrastructure while delivering maximum sequential read speeds up to 560MB/s and sequential write speeds up to 510MB/s. The 2.5-inch form factor with hot-plug capability ensures easy integration into most server configurations without requiring system downtime for installation or replacement.

Physical Dimensions and Installation

Measuring 100.5mm x 69.85mm x 7mm, this SSD fits standard 2.5-inch drive bays in servers and storage arrays. The hot-plug capability allows for drive replacement or addition while the system remains operational, a critical feature for maintaining high availability in enterprise environments.

Endurance and Reliability Specifications

With its read-intensive design, the Dell 400-AXTV 480GB SSD offers a endurance rating of 0.8 Drive Writes Per Day (DWPD) over a 5-year warranty period. This translates to approximately 350TB Total Bytes Written (TBW), providing sufficient endurance for typical read-heavy server workloads while maintaining data integrity and longevity.

Advanced Error Correction and Data Protection

The drive incorporates advanced error correction code (ECC) technology and end-to-end data path protection to ensure data integrity from host to NAND and back. This comprehensive protection scheme guards against data corruption during transmission and storage, critical for maintaining data reliability in enterprise applications.

Advanced Features and Technologies

TLC NAND with Enhanced Durability

The use of Triple-Level Cell (TLC) NAND flash memory provides an optimal balance between cost, capacity, and performance for read-intensive applications. Dell has implemented advanced wear-leveling algorithms and over-provisioning to extend the lifespan of the TLC NAND, ensuring reliable performance throughout the drive's warranty period.

Power-Loss Protection Mechanisms

Enterprise-grade power-loss protection circuits safeguard data in transit during unexpected power failures. This feature ensures that data being written to the drive is not corrupted during power loss events, maintaining data integrity in mission-critical environments.

SATA 6Gbps Interface Advantages

While newer NVMe interfaces offer higher performance, the SATA 6Gbps interface remains relevant for many server applications due to its widespread compatibility, cost-effectiveness, and sufficient performance for many read-intensive workloads. The interface provides a practical upgrade path from traditional hard disk drives without requiring complete infrastructure overhaul.

Backward Compatibility Considerations

The 512e (512-byte emulation) sector formatting ensures compatibility with older operating systems and server hardware that may not support the newer 4K native sector format. This backward compatibility simplifies migration from older storage technologies while still providing modern performance benefits.

Performance Characteristics and Benchmarks

Sustained Read Performance

The read-intensive design of the Dell 400-AXTV prioritizes consistent read performance under sustained workloads. With sequential read speeds up to 560MB/s and random read performance up to 75,000 IOPS (4KB transfers), the drive delivers responsive performance for data retrieval operations common in server environments.

Quality of Service Metrics

Enterprise SSDs are evaluated not just on peak performance but on consistent performance under varying workloads. The Dell 400-AXTV maintains predictable latency and consistent IOPS performance, with 99.9% of read I/Os completing within specified latency targets, ensuring reliable application performance.

Write Performance Considerations

While optimized for read operations, the drive still delivers respectable write performance with sequential write speeds up to 510MB/s and random write performance up to 14,000 IOPS (4KB transfers). The write performance is sufficient for typical read-intensive workloads while maintaining the cost advantages of the read-intensive design.

Write Amplification and Garbage Collection

Advanced garbage collection algorithms and background maintenance operations help maintain consistent write performance over time by efficiently managing NAND flash blocks. The drive's controller minimizes write amplification, extending the lifespan of the TLC NAND flash memory.
